Bandit is telling as it is, we see a lot of LMT gear and quality is spotty - what is good is good but the rest is below par.  I don't have a dog in this fight just saying what we see and use which is at least 10 times more than anyone else.  Hopefully they will improve as their stuff is good and well thought out.  The short uppers are bullet-proof, but not fool-proof, the enhanced carrier has not proved its worth, the LMT bolt works well and the extractor springs go in the high 20 to low 30k range.  
HFG
